Published at 7:06 AM UTC on April 22, 2026, multiple industry sources confirm Netflix is in late-stage negotiations to purchase the Radford Studio Center, a 17-acre production facility in the heart of Los Angeles’ Studio City neighborhood. The transaction would represent the first major Hollywood studio lot acquisition in Netflix’s 29-year history, and signals a strategic shift toward greater control over in-house content production infrastructure. Expert Insights

From a fundamental strategic perspective, the potential Radford Studio acquisition aligns with the broader streaming industry’s multi-year pivot from subscriber growth at all costs to operating margin expansion and sustainable free cash flow (FCF) generation. Over the past three years, average studio rental costs in the Los Angeles metro area have risen 27% per commercial real estate data from CBRE, as demand for scripted film and television production outpaces available supply. For Netflix, which spent $17.3 billion on content production in 2025, owning a dedicated studio lot could deliver annual operating cost savings of $40 to $60 million if utilization rates hit the 80% industry benchmark for owned production facilities, with a projected payback period of 7 to 9 years, assuming a purchase price in line with the $750 million to $850 million estimated fair value for the Radford property. From a valuation standpoint, Netflix’s current near-fair-value pricing means the transaction will only act as a material share price catalyst if the final terms deviate sharply from market expectations. A purchase price below $800 million with minimal required capex upgrades would likely be viewed as accretive to long-term operating margins, while a price tag above $900 million could pressure near-term FCF, particularly as Netflix has allocated $10 billion to share repurchase programs in 2026. The balanced valuation also means investors are not currently pricing in excessive growth expectations, so upside or downside from the deal will be tied directly to execution. On the risk front, the addition of fixed production assets will introduce new non-cash depreciation expenses to Netflix’s income statement, which already features complex line items related to content amortization and international tax adjustments. This increased accounting complexity could lead to wider gaps between GAAP and non-GAAP earnings results, potentially raising near-term stock volatility if quarterly results miss consensus estimates due to non-operational accounting adjustments, rather than core subscriber or content performance. Notably, the recent 12.9% weekly pullback in Netflix shares is tied to broader macro-driven rotation out of large-cap tech stocks, rather than company-specific news, meaning the potential acquisition is not yet priced into current trading levels. Investors should look for management commentary on the transaction during Netflix’s Q2 2026 earnings call to clarify how the purchase aligns with its long-term capital allocation framework, particularly as the company has historically prioritized content spending and share repurchases over large fixed asset investments.
